Payed VS Paid
The basic difference lies in the meaning of pay.
Pay is an irregular verb. It refers to returning some favors or hiring someone for money, or fulfilling a debt.
Payed is the past tense of the rare meaning of ‘pay,'. It refers to coating a boat or its parts with some sort of waterproof material.
